herringbone

 

Definitions from WordNet

Noun herringbone has 1 sense
  1. herringbone - a twilled fabric with a herringbone pattern
    --1 is a kind of
    fabric, cloth, material, textile

Herringbone

Definition:

A herringbone is a pattern in which rows of diagonal lines or shapes are repeated to resemble the skeleton of a fish.

Part of speech: n

Sense 1:

A pattern resembling the skeleton of a fish, consisting of rows of slanting parallel lines.

Example sentence: The herringbone design on the floor added a touch of elegance to the room.

Sense 2:

A fabric featuring a woven pattern of V or chevron-shaped parallel lines.

Example sentence: The tailor used herringbone fabric for the coat's lining to give it a classic touch.
